What are the duties and responsibilities of a nurse?
Answer»
The
ESSENTIAL
responsibility of a nurse is to
SUPPORT
and care for patients of all
TRADITIONAL
origins and religious backgrounds.
Keeping the record of the medical history of the patient and the symptoms.
Should know how to
OPERATE
medical equipment.
Participation with a team in the planning for patient care
